Beautiful example of Alexander’s band.
Look closely at the fainter rainbow and you will see that the colors are inverted. Red, orange, and yellow are at the top of the main rainbow and they are at the bottom of the faint rainbow. In the very, very rare triple rainbow the colors are inverted again.
